html {
	height: 100%;
}

body {
	background-color: #A9BFD8;
	margin: 0;
	padding: 0;
	background-image: url(../img/fond.jpg);
	background-position: 0 0;
	background-repeat: repeat;
	height: 100%;
}

#container {
	position: absolute;
	left: 50%;
	top: 5px;
	width: 800px;
	height: 580px;
	margin-top: 0px;
	margin-left: -400px;
	text-align: left;
	padding: 0px;
}

p,span,table {
	font-family: verdana,arial,helvetica,s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	margin: 0;
	padding: 0;
	border-collapse: collapse;
	line-height: 130%;
}

.t7 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:7px;font-weight:normal}
.t7b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:7px;font-weight:bold}
.t8 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:8px;font-weight:normal}
.t8b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:8px;font-weight:bold}
.t9 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:9px;font-weight:normal}
.t9b {font-family:Verdana, Arial, Helvetica, sans-serif;FONT-SIZE:9px;FONT-WEIGHT:bold} 
.t10 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:10px;font-weight:normal}
.t10b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:10px;font-weight:bold}
.t11 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:11px;font-weight:normal}
.t11b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:11px;font-weight:bold}
.t12 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:12px;font-weight:normal}
.t12b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:12px;font-weight:bold}
.t13 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:13px;font-weight:normal}
.t13b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:13px;font-weight:bold}
.t14 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:14px;font-weight:normal}
.t14b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:14px;font-weight:bold}
.t15 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:15px;font-weight:normal}
.t15b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:15px;font-weight:bold}
.t16 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:16px;font-weight:normal}
.t16b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:16px;font-weight:bold}
.t17 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:17px;font-weight:normal}
.t17b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:17px;font-weight:bold}
.t18 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:18px;font-weight:normal}
.t18b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:18px;font-weight:bold}
.t20 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:20px;font-weight:normal}
.t20b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:20px;font-weight:bold}
.t21 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:21px;font-weight:normal}
.t21b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:21px;font-weight:bold}
.t22 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:22px;font-weight:normal}
.t22b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:22px;font-weight:bold}
.t24 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:24px;font-weight:normal}
.t24b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:24px;font-weight:bold}
.t25 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:25px;font-weight:normal}
.t25b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:25px;font-weight:bold}
.t26 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:26px;font-weight:normal}
.t26b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:26px;font-weight:bold}
.t28 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:28px;font-weight:normal}
.t28b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:28px;font-weight:bold}
.t30 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:30px;font-weight:normal}
.t30b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:30px;font-weight:bold}
.t32 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:32px;font-weight:normal}
.t32b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:32px;font-weight:bold}
.t34 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:34px;font-weight:normal}
.t34b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:34px;font-weight:bold}
.t36 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:36px;font-weight:normal}
.t36b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:36px;font-weight:bold}
.t48 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:48px;font-weight:normal}
.t48b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:48px;font-weight:bold}
.t60 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:60px;font-weight:normal}
.t60b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:60px;font-weight:bold}
.t72 {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:72px;font-weight:normal}
.t72b {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:72px;font-weight:bold}

A {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:11px;
}

A: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size:11px;
}                  
   
A.navigation {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:darkblue;
	text-decoration:none;
	font-weight:bold;
	font-size:11px;
}

A.navigation: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:steelblue;
	text-decoration:none;
	font-weight:bold;
	font-size:11px;
}                  
   
A.liens_photos {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#082984;
	font-weight:bold;
	font-size:9px;
}

A.liens_photos: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#082984;
	text-decoration:none;
	font-weight:bold;
	font-size:9px;
}                  
   
A.no_photo {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#082984;
	font-weight:bold;
	font-size:11px;
}

A.no_photo: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	text-decoration:none;
	font-weight:bold;
	font-size:11px;
}                  
   
A.tri {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	font-weight: normal;
	font-size:11px;
}

A.tri: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ight: normal;
	font-size:11px;
}                  
   
A.page_selected {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: white;
	font-weight:bold;
	font-size:11px;
	border: 1px solid #FFFFFF;
	padding: 2px;
}

A.page_selected: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size:11px;
}                  

A.page_notselected {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#082984;
	font-weight:bold;
	font-size:11px;
}

A.page_notselected: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	text-decoration:none;
	font-weight:bold;
	font-size:11px;
}                  

TH {
	font-family:Verdana, Arial, Helvetica, sans-serif;
  background-color:darkblue;
	color: white;   
  text-align:center
}

TEXTAREA {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:normal;
	color:steelblue;
}    

INPUT {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#1B3255;
}

INPUT.bouton {
	font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:10px;
  font-weight:bold;
  color: white;     
  background-color:#808080;
	cursor:hand;
}

INPUT.bouton_darkgreen {
	font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:10px;
  font-weight:bold;
  color:white;     
  background-color:darkgreen;
	cursor:hand;
}

span.navigation,a.navigation,a.navigation:visited {
	font: normal 11px verdana,arial,helvetica;
	color: #1B3255;
}
a.navigation:hover {
	font: normal 11px verdana,arial,helvetica;
	color: #000000;
}
select.moteur-recherche {
	width: 120px;
	height: 16px;
	font: normal 11px verdana,arial,helvetica;
	color: #1B3255;
	border: 0;
}
span.mentions-legales {
	font: bold 9px verdana,arial,helvetica;
	color: #29446F;
}
a.mentions-legales,a.mentions-legales:visited {
	font: bold 9px verdana,arial,helvetica;
	color: #29446F;
	text-decoration: underline;
}

a.mentions-legales:hover {
	font: bold 9px verdana,arial,helvetica;
	text-decoration: none;
	color: #000000;
}
.Titre1 {font-size: 17px; font-family: verdana,arial,helvetica, sans-serif; font-weight: bold; color: #FFFFFF;}
.Titre2 {font-size: 14px; font-family: verdana,arial,helvetica, sans-serif; font-weight: bold; color: #FFFFFF;}
a.Lien-Texte {
	font: normal 11px verdana,arial,hel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ration: underline;
}
a.Lien-Texte:hover {
	font: normal 11px verdana,arial,helvetica, sans-serif;
  color:#FFFFFF;
	text-decoration: none;
}
input.bouton {
	font: bold 11px verdana;
	color: #FFFFFF;
	background-color: #4073C2;
	cursor: hand;
	border: 1px solid #082984;
	height: 18px;
}
